Web29 mrt. 2024 · To form a Colorado S corp, you’ll need to ensure your company has a Colorado formal business structure (LLC or corporation), and then you can elect S corp tax designation. If you’ve already formed an LLC or corporation, file Form 2553 with the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) to designate S corp taxation status.
